The Evolution of Vacuum Cleaners
Vacuum have come a long method because their beginning in the early 1900s. Standard models needed manual operation, which typically included carrying around heavy equipment and dealing with troublesome cords. The intro of electric designs brought about increased suction power and benefit, however the true revolution began with the development of robotic and smart vacuum cleaners.
Key Milestones in Vacuum Evolution:
- 1901: The first powered vacuum was developed by Hubert Cecil Booth.
- 1937: The first container vacuum was developed by Electrolux.
- 1986: The launching of the first robotic vacuum cleaner, 'Electrolux's Trilobite'.
- 2002: iRobot launched Roomba, setting the phase for automated floor cleaning.
The increase of smart technology has even more boosted client expectations, resulting in the development of vacuum cleaners equipped with expert system (AI), mobile phones, and sensors that enable for autonomous operation.
Features of Smart Vacuum Cleaners
Smart vacuum cleaners provide a series of features created to improve home chores. Below are some of the most significant qualities:
Feature
Description
Navigation Technology
Utilizes sensing units and electronic cameras for mapping your home and effectively navigating around barriers.
Wi-Fi Connectivity
Allows users to control the vacuum through smartphone apps, making it easier to arrange cleanings from anywhere.
Voice Control Integration
Compatible with smart home assistants like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ant for hands-free operation.
Programmable Schedules
Lets users set cleaning schedules, making sure the home is cleaned even when they are away.
Self-Charging Capability
Go back to its charging station automatically when battery is low, guaranteeing it's constantly all set for the next task.
Dirt Detection
Senses the level of dirt in an area and increases suction power accordingly for ideal performance.
Multi-Surface Cleaning
Effectively transitions in between carpets, wood, and tiles, preserving performance on all floor types.
Types of Smart Vacuum Cleaners
- Robotic Vacuums: Autonomous gadgets that navigate and clean floorings with minimal human intervention.
- Stick Vacuums: Lightweight, portable smart gadgets developed for quick clean-ups and tight spaces.
- Cylinder Vacuums: Compact vacuums that preserve strong suction power, ideal for cleaning different surface areas.
- Upright Vacuums: Traditional style with modern-day enhancements, perfect for deep cleaning carpets and large areas.
Advantages of Smart Vacuum Cleaners
Utilizing smart vacuum cleaners presents a number of advantages over standard cleaning techniques:
Time-Saving: Automating the cleaning process maximizes valuable time for homeowners. Instead of dedicating hours to cleaning, users can set a schedule and go about their everyday activities.
Boosted Efficiency: Smart vacuums usually have superior suction and navigation capabilities, which permit extensive cleaning in less time.
Personalized Cleaning: With smart device apps, users can customize cleaning schedules and locations, making it possible for accurate maintenance tailored to individual requirements.
Ease of access and Convenience: Smart vacuums are easy to run, permitting users to control cleaning from anywhere, whether home or on holiday.
Improved Health: Equipped with sophisticated filtration systems, these vacuums can lower irritants and improve air quality in the home.
Factors to consider Before Purchasing
While smart vacuum cleaners provide various benefits, there are factors prospective purchasers should consider:
Price Point: Smart vacuums are normally more pricey than standard designs. Budget and functions need to align with property owner needs.
Home Layout: Complex designs with heavy furnishings or special layout might posture navigation obstacles.
Upkeep: Regular cleaning of the vacuum itself is required for optimal efficiency.
Battery Life: Consider the battery period of a robotic vacuum, especially for larger homes. Some designs may deal with long cleaning times.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How do I preserve my smart vacuum cleaner?
To preserve a smart vacuum:
- Regularly empty the dust container.
- Tidy brushes and filters periodically.
- Keep sensors totally free of dirt and blockage to guarantee reliable navigation.
2. Can I utilize a smart vacuum on carpets?
Yes, the majority of smart vacuum are designed to effectively tidy carpets, wood floors, and tiles. auto vacuum -end models even have settings to change suction power for different surfaces.

4. Can I manage my smart vacuum with my smartphone?
Yes, most smart vacuum feature associated mobile phone apps that permit users to control cleaning schedules, start/stop cleaning, and view cleaning logs.
5. Do smart vacuums go back to their charging station immediately?
Yes, a lot of smart vacuums have self-charging capabilities and will automatically return to their charging dock when the battery runs low or after completing a cleaning session.
